
When considering how many gallons are in one tin of paint, it’s important to note that paint tins are typically measured in liters or quarts rather than gallons. A standard tin of paint usually holds around 1 gallon, which is equivalent to approximately 3.785 liters or 4 quarts. However, paint containers can vary in size, ranging from smaller 0.5-gallon tins to larger 5-gallon buckets, depending on the intended use and manufacturer. Understanding the volume of paint in a tin is crucial for estimating coverage, planning projects, and ensuring you purchase the right amount for your needs.

What You'll Learn

Standard tin sizes and their gallon equivalents
Paint tins come in various sizes, each designed for specific project needs. Understanding the standard tin sizes and their gallon equivalents is crucial for accurate estimation and cost-effective purchasing. A common size is the 1-gallon tin, which holds exactly 1 gallon of paint, covering approximately 350 to 400 square feet per coat. This size is ideal for small to medium-sized rooms or touch-up projects. For larger areas, a 5-gallon tin is often used, containing 5 gallons of paint and covering around 1,750 to 2,000 square feet, making it a practical choice for whole-house painting or commercial projects.
Analyzing smaller tins reveals their utility in specialized applications. A quart-sized tin, equivalent to 0.25 gallons, is perfect for accent walls, small furniture, or testing colors. This size minimizes waste and expense when only a small amount of paint is needed. Similarly, a pint-sized tin, holding 0.125 gallons, is excellent for minor repairs or crafting projects. These smaller sizes are often sold in multi-packs, offering convenience and variety for diverse tasks.
When comparing standard tin sizes, it’s essential to consider the project scope and desired finish. For instance, a 2.5-gallon tin, less common but still available, strikes a balance between the 1-gallon and 5-gallon options. It covers approximately 875 to 1,000 square feet, making it suitable for large rooms or multiple smaller spaces. Choosing the right size ensures efficiency and reduces the likelihood of running out of paint mid-project or overbuying.
Practical tips for selecting the correct tin size include measuring the area to be painted and accounting for multiple coats. As a rule of thumb, add 10% to the total calculated paint volume to accommodate for uneven surfaces or darker colors requiring more coverage. Additionally, consider the paint type and finish, as some formulations may have different coverage rates. Always check the manufacturer’s guidelines for specific product details to ensure accurate estimation.

Conversion formulas for paint volume measurements
Paint volume measurements vary widely depending on the manufacturer and region, making conversions essential for accurate project planning. A standard tin of paint typically holds 1 gallon, but sizes like quarts, pints, and liters are also common. Understanding conversion formulas ensures you purchase the right amount, avoiding waste or shortages. For instance, 1 gallon equals 4 quarts or 8 pints, while 1 liter is roughly 0.26 gallons. These relationships form the foundation for precise calculations in any painting endeavor.
To convert between units, start with basic formulas. For example, to convert gallons to quarts, multiply the gallon value by 4 (e.g., 2 gallons = 8 quarts). Conversely, divide quarts by 4 to get gallons. When working with liters, use the conversion factor 1 liter ≈ 0.264 gallons. For instance, a 5-liter tin holds approximately 1.32 gallons. These formulas are straightforward but require attention to detail, especially when scaling up for large projects like exterior walls or commercial spaces.
Practical application of these conversions often involves mixed units. Suppose you have 3 gallons and 2 quarts of paint. First, convert the quarts to gallons (2 quarts ÷ 4 = 0.5 gallons), then add to the gallon total (3 + 0.5 = 3.5 gallons). This approach ensures consistency, particularly when combining leftover paint from different containers. Always round to the nearest practical value, as precision beyond tenths of a gallon rarely impacts residential projects.
Caution is necessary when relying on manufacturer labels, as "1-gallon" tins may contain slightly less due to settling or packaging variations. Always measure or weigh the paint if accuracy is critical, especially for custom mixes or professional work. Additionally, consider the paint’s density, as thicker paints (e.g., textured or exterior varieties) may occupy less volume than their container suggests. Cross-referencing volume with weight can provide a more reliable estimate in such cases.

How coverage area affects gallon estimation
A single gallon of paint typically covers 350 to 400 square feet per coat, but this range is far from absolute. Coverage area directly influences how many gallons you’ll need for a project, yet it’s a variable often underestimated. For instance, a 10x10 room (100 square feet) might require just a quarter-gallon for one coat, while a large living room (300 square feet) could demand nearly a full gallon. The key takeaway? Always calculate the total square footage of your surface area before estimating gallons, factoring in walls, ceilings, and trim separately.
Surface texture plays a critical role in coverage area, complicating gallon estimation. Porous surfaces like bare drywall or rough wood absorb more paint, reducing coverage by up to 20%. In contrast, smooth surfaces like primed walls or metal require less paint per square foot. For example, a gallon might cover only 300 square feet on unpainted drywall but stretch to 400 square feet on a primed surface. To adjust for texture, consider applying a primer first, which seals the surface and improves paint adherence, ultimately conserving gallons.
The number of coats required amplifies the impact of coverage area on gallon estimation. Light colors or high-quality paints might achieve full coverage in one coat, but darker shades or lower-quality options often need two or more. For a 15x15 room (225 square feet), one coat might use 0.56 gallons, but two coats double the requirement to 1.12 gallons. Always account for multiple coats in your calculations, especially when switching colors drastically or working with high-contrast surfaces like bright red to soft white.
Practical tips can refine your gallon estimation based on coverage area. First, measure each wall or surface individually and sum the totals for accuracy. Second, use online paint calculators that factor in surface type, paint quality, and coats. Third, buy 10–20% extra paint to account for spillage, touch-ups, or miscalculations. For example, if calculations suggest 2.5 gallons, round up to 3 gallons. Finally, store leftover paint properly for future projects, reducing waste and saving costs.
